Property Location
When you stay at DoubleTree by Hilton Cocoa Beach Oceanfront in Cocoa Beach, you'll be near the beach, within a 15-minute drive of Cocoa Beach Pier and Port Canaveral. This beach hotel is 13.4 mi (21.5 km) from Cocoa Expo Sports Center and 0.4 mi (0.7 km) from Lori Wilson Park.

Rooms
Make yourself at home in one of the 148 air-conditioned rooms featuring refrigerators and microwaves. Flat-screen televisions with cable programming provide entertainment, while complimentary wireless Internet access keeps you connected. Private bathrooms with shower/tub combinations feature designer toiletries and hair dryers. Conveniences include phones, as well as desks and complimentary weekday newspapers.

Amenities
Take advantage of recreation opportunities including a health club and an outdoor pool. Additional amenities at this hotel include complimentary wireless Internet access, gift shops/newsstands, and wedding services.

Dining
Enjoy American cuisine at 3 Wishes, a restaurant which features a bar, or stay in and take advantage of the room service (during limited hours). Wrap up your day with a drink at the poolside bar. Breakfast is available for a fee.

Business, Other Amenities
Featured amenities include complimentary wired Internet access, a business center, and express check-in. Free self parking is available onsite.
